All right, so we're trying to figure out the domain.
00:07
And just as a reminder, domain are the possible input values.
00:24
Or, in other words, are possible x's.
00:28
So the way i kind of think of this is i want to scan left to right, which values are included.
00:35
So if i look here, it looks like i have x's between negative 3 and 5.
00:46
Because there are no breaks in between.
00:48
Now, to write this in interval notation, we have to decide are our endpoints included or not.
00:54
Well, we have a closed circle over here on the left hand side.
01:00
That means it's included.
01:02
We have an open circle over here, which means it's not included.
01:07
So our domain then would be, if we include a value, we use a square bracket.
01:16
So it's going to be negative three, comma until 5 not included, which means it's a parentheses...
